DEPARTMENT OF AGRICULTURE
Forest Service
North Central Idaho Resource Advisory Committee
AGENCY: Forest Service, USDA.
ACTION: Notice of meeting.
-----------------------------------------------------------------------
SUMMARY: The North Central Idaho RAC will meet in Grangeville, Idaho.
The committee is meeting as authorized under the Secure Rural Schools
and Community Self-Determination Act (Pub. L. 110-343) and in
compliance with the Federal Advisory Committee Act. The purpose of the
meeting is to select projects for 2012. The authority of the RAC to
recommend projects expires on September 30, 2011, so they need to
complete recommendations for two year's worth of projects in the next
few months.
